Job Description
- Provide nursing care using the nursing process to assess patient and caregiver needs.
- Develop and communicate realistic, evidence-based plans of care including patient/caregiver involvement.
- Serve as Case Manager for assigned patients, managing caseloads and visit times per productivity standards.
- Complete OASIS documentation accurately and timely, staying current with documentation requirements.
- Implement medical plans of care, nursing interventions, and procedures to ensure safe, effective quality care.
- Maintain and update skills in IV use and maintenance, wound VAC, complex wound care, and infection control.
- Collaborate with LPNs within their scope of practice, delegate tasks, and review documentation.
- Evaluate and adjust plans of care based on patient responses and identified problems.
- Maintain accurate nursing care documentation for effective communication within the healthcare team.
- Follow agency protocols for visit documentation and completion.
- Educate patients and caregivers on medication side effects, treatment options, discharge instructions, and reportable conditions.
- Identify and communicate interdisciplinary patient needs (e.g., physical therapy, social work) promptly.
- Complete required agency, state, and federal forms (e.g., HHABN, Medicare Notice of Non-Coverage) timely.
- Manage visits efficiently, ensuring supervisory visits are not combined with routine visits.
- Assess patient needs for Home Care Aide services, develop and coordinate plans of care, and supervise accordingly.
- Report patient incidents (infections, injuries) promptly to Quality Improvement specialists.
- Coordinate safe patient discharges and transfers, ensuring all paperwork and information are processed correctly.
- Collaborate with physicians, providers, team members, and vendors to support the plan of care.
- Participate in monthly peer review audits and case conferences to improve communication and care quality.
- Advocate proactively for patient care issues sensitive to individual patient and family needs.
- Participate actively in interdisciplinary team (IDT) meetings to develop and update individualized plans of care.
- Stay current on pain control, symptom management, and high-tech nursing skills relevant to home care.

About Rutland, VT
As a Travel Home Health Nurse in Rutland, VT here's what you should know:- Rutland's cost of living is slightly lower than the national average, making it an affordable place to live.
- Wages generally match up with the lower cost of living, providing a good balance for residents.
- Average summer highs range from 75°F to 80°F, while winter lows can drop to 10°F to 15°F.
- Rutland experiences all four seasons, with beautiful fall foliage and ample snowfall in winter, perfect for outdoor enthusiasts.
- Short term rentals and furnished housing options are available in Rutland, and they are relatively easy to find due to the city's popularity among visitors and seasonal tourists.
- Rutland is car-friendly with easy access to major highways.
- Public transportation options are limited, but the city is walkable and bike-friendly, especially in the downtown area.
- Rutland has a diverse population with a wide age range.
- Common health issues in the area may include seasonal allergies due to the lush natural surroundings.
- There is a growing population of travel nurses due to the city's proximity to healthcare facilities and outdoor recreational opportunities.
- Rutland offers a variety of restaurants, shops, and entertainment options in its Downtown Historic District.
- The city hosts the Vermont Farmers Market and special events throughout the year, providing ample opportunities for socializing and enjoying local culture.
- Outdoor enthusiasts can explore hiking trails and nearby ski areas, while art and music enthusiasts can attend shows at the Paramount Theatre.
